Rookie wins NASCAR pole

DARLINGTON, S.C., March 19 (UPI) -- Kasey Kahne continued his solid rookie season Friday, grabbing the pole just ahead of Dale Earnhardt, Jr. for Sunday's NASCAR Carolina Dodge Dealers 400.

Kahne ran his Dodge Intrepid around the 1.366-mile track at 171.716 miles per hour. Earnhardt was second at 171.154 mph in a Chevrolet Monte Carlo with Greg Biffle third at 171.083 mph in a Ford Taurus.

It was the second pole of the young season for Kahne, tying him with Ryan Newman for the series lead.

Kahne has not been worse than third in the last three Nextel Cup races, posting runner-up finishes to Matt Kenseth in North Carolina and Las Vegas. He was third last week in Atlanta, where Earnhardt earned his second win of he year.

Kenseth, who leads the Nextel Cup standings with 673 points, qualified 15th in his Ford.

Tony Stewart qualified eighth in a Chevrolet. He is second in the championship race, just ahead of Earnhardt and Kahne.
